Both Truesdale twins recently went back on the board after reopening their recruiting from Central Michigan. On Sunday, Dereon was among the stars at the Hoosier Basketball Magazine Top 60 Workout showcasing his elite athleticism while consistently slicing his way to the rim off of the dribble. His explosiveness on both ends of the floor makes him an intriguing Division I prospect late in this recruiting cycle.

This Central Michigan commit had a great weekend at the GRBA National Championship. Truesdale scored 20 points in an impressive come-from-behind victory for OPS – Black at 8:30 on Sunday morning. Trailing by double-figures in the second half, OPS – Black came roaring back, led by Truesdale, to defeat Full Package – Black 64-62. His length and athleticism makes it very hard for opposing defenses to keep him out of the paint.
